We’re seeking an experienced Automation Engineer with a strong background in Ignition SCADA to join a global leader in the pharmaceutical industry. This role offers the opportunity to contribute to world-class manufacturing systems that enable the production of life-changing medicines. You’ll play a key part in deploying, configuring, and optimizing Ignition SCADA systems across multiple international sites—enhancing efficiency, compliance, and data connectivity within a cutting-edge automation environment.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ead and support Ignition SCADA deployments across multiple global manufacturing sites.
  • Develop, maintain, and optimize global use case templates to ensure consistent SCADA deployment standards.
  • Roll out standardized global templates, driving best practices and uniformity across all facilities.
  • Collaborate with IT and engineering teams to build interfaces between Ignition and enterprise systems such as ERP, MES, and LIMS.
  • Develop and update engineering standards, procedures, and documentation for automation and SCADA implementations.
  • Troubleshoot, maintain, and optimize Ignition systems to ensure maximum uptime and system performance.
  • Provide training and technical support to local engineering and operations personnel on Ignition best practices.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Computer Science, or a related discipline.
  • 3–5 years of experience in automation roles within the pharmaceutical or life sciences sector.
  • Demonstrated hands-on experience with Ignition SCADA, including deployment, configuration, and system optimization.
  • Solid understanding of GMP, FDA, and related regulatory standards.
  • Proven ability to deliver SCADA-to-enterprise integrations (ERP/MES/SQL systems).
  • Strong collaboration and communication skills, with experience working across global, cross-functional teams.
  • Competent in engineering documentation, with the ability to author and maintain automation procedures and technical guides.
